Quick and Easy Chicken Fricassee Recipe
- 300 g rice
- 600 g chicken breast
- 30 g butter
- 30 g flour
- 300 ml chicken broth or more
- 100 ml cream
- salt
- pepper
- lemon juice optional
- chicken stock powder optional
- 10 g fresh parsley optional
- If you plan to use rice as a side dish, start cooking it first because it takes the longest to prepare.
- In a casserole, prepare the roux by melting the butter, adding flour, and frying it over medium heat for 3 minutes. Then, add chicken broth and whisk vigorously.
- Add the cream and season the sauce with salt, pepper, fresh lemon juice or chicken stock powder, if you have it.
- If you are unhappy with the consistency - add more broth (or water or milk) and correct the seasoning.
- Place the lid on the casserole and keep the sauce warm over low heat.
- Wash and tap dry the chicken breasts.
- Cut them into bite-size pieces against the grain.
- Preheat the pan and melt some vegetable oil in it.
- Cook the chicken breast over medium heat until it is tender. To enhance the dish with roasting aromas, you may increase the heat to medium-high, although it is unnecessary.
- Once the chicken pieces are tender, pour the sauce over them and allow the aromas to combine. Adjust the seasoning if necessary.
- Serve with rice and fresh parsley.

What is German Chicken Fricassee?
German chicken fricassee, or Hühnerfrikassee, is a classic dish in German and French cuisine. It is a creamy chicken stew traditionally made with cooked chicken, a rich white sauce, and sometimes various vegetables. The dish is hearty, comforting, and mild in flavour, making it a popular family meal.
Historical Background of Fricassee
The dish’s name can be found in German and French writings dating back to the 18th century. However, at that time, Fricassee could have been made from different types of meat and served with various kinds of sauces (not necessarily white). Cooked veal and dove meat were also popular choices to make Fricassee.

Grandmother's Traditional Chicken Fricassee Recipe
Secrets to Grandma’s Flavorful Chicken Fricassee is a homemade chicken broth made from Suppenhuhn (Stewing Hen) and tender chicken meat. A stewing hen is an older hen that no longer lays eggs and is used explicitly for making flavorful broths and soups. Its meat is firmer and less tender than that of younger chickens, but it has a richer flavour.

Essential Ingredients for the Creamy Sauce
The base to a creamy sauce for Chicken Fricassee is light roux. Making it is beyond easy. You just need to melt the butter, mix it with flour (by using a whisk) and frying it for 3 minutes on medium heat. The last step is to pour the chicken stock all over the butter-flour mixture

Vegetable Options for a Flavorful Twist
If you like to throw in some other ingredients to make the dish more nourishing, I would suggest adding:
- mushroom slices
- cubed carrots
- fresh or frozen green peas
- white asparagus
- cauliflour
- morels – for an extra fancy meal

Best Side Dishes to Accompany German Chicken Fricassee
Hühnerfrikassee is traditionally served with white rice, which perfectly complements the creamy sauce. If you don’t have rice, serve it with pasta or cooked potatoes. You can prepare a side salad if you do not use any vegetables, to balance the meal.

Storage & Reheating

Store Chicken Fricassee in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

You can keep the dish for up to 3 months in the freezer.

The best way to reheat frozen or cold Chicken Fricassee is to heat it up in the coated pan very slowly.
